Instructions
Cook the Quinoa
Rinse quinoa and cook in 2 cups water until fluffy, about 15 minutes.
Prepare the Turkey
In a skillet, heat olive oil over medium heat. Add garlic and ground turkey, cook until browned.
Add Beans and Veggies
Stir in black beans, corn, cherry tomatoes, bell peppers, and red onion.
Season the Mixture
Add chili powder, cumin, paprika, oregano, salt, and pepper. Cook for another 3-5 minutes.
Combine Ingredients
In a bowl, layer cooked quinoa and the turkey mixture. Drizzle with lime juice.
Garnish and Serve
Top with fresh cilantro and serve warm.
